  • Abstract
    A hybrid method of magnetic field calculation in slotless/slotted permanent magnet machines is proposed. Depending on the chosen calculation model, the method combines 2D/3D analytical solutions in the airgap with Grinberg´s/boundary element or finite element methods for other regions of the motor. The fast convergence between different types of solutions is achieved by using the Schwartz technique for overlapping sub-regions
